Missing authorization in macOS - CVE-2025-24271

 

Missing authorization in macOS - CVE-2025-24271

Published: April 29, 2025 / Updated: May 9, 2025


Vulnerability identifier: #VU108022
CSH Severity: Medium
CVSS v4: 5.3 [CVSS:4.0/AV:A/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
CVE-ID: CVE-2025-24271
CWE-ID: CWE-862
Exploitation vector: Adjecent network
Exploit availability: Public exploit is available

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to bypass authorization checks.

The vulnerability exists due to missing authorization checks in AirPlay. A remote non-authenticated attacker on the same network as a signed-in Mac can send it AirPlay commands without pairing.


Affected software

macOS
visionOS
iPadOS
tvOS

How to mitigate CVE-2025-24271

Install updates from vendor's website.

macOS - addressed in versions 15.4 24E248, 13.7.5 22H527, 14.7.5 23H527
visionOS - update to 2.4
iPadOS - update to 17.7.6
tvOS - update to 18.4
